WASHINGTON, March 11 (UPI) — Apple’s iTunes, App Store and iCloud applications suffered outages on Wednesday morning, leaving users unable to make purchases, process downloads or access cloud services.

Users in the United States, Switzerland, Hong Kong and the United Kingdom were affected.

Outages for the affected services began at about 5 a.m.. App Store, iTunes Store, Mac App Store and iBook Store services were still “unavailable for all users” hours later.

Services to iCloud Accounts and iCloud Mail were restored about 9 a.m. Complaints were filed in Apple’s support forums by users. The Twitter hash tags “#appstoredown” and “#itunesdown” helped spread the word.
